> SVN_REVISION environment variable not available to promote build shell command
> ------------------------------------------------------------------------------

> When adding a shell action to a promotion process on a job that is using
> subversion source control the SVN_REVISION environment variable is not
> provided. The BUILD_NUMBER environment variable is there and correct, so we
> can work around it as so:
> {noformat}export SVN_REVISION=`wget -qO-
> http://<host>/job/spike-application/${BUILD_NUMBER}/api/xml?tree=changeSet[revisions[revision]]
> | grep -o "[0-9]\+"`
> echo PROMOTED ${SVN_REVISION} from unstable to stable{noformat}
> However, that's obviously horrible and given the BUILD_NUMBER is available it
> should be possible to retrieve the SVN_REVISION without an HTTP request.
